30 Description: bug tracking system based on the active Debian BTS
31 Debian has a bug tracking system which files details of bugs reported by
32 users and developers. Each bug is given a number, and is kept on file until
33 it is marked as having been dealt with. The system is mainly controlled by
34 e-mail, but the bug reports can be viewed using the WWW.
36 This version is fully functional, but it does not automatically configure.
37 See /usr/share/doc/debbugs/README.Debian after installation.
